TODAY IN HISTORY
TODAY’S HIGHLIGHTS
Sept. 21, 1938
A hurricane struck parts of New York and New England, causing widespread damage and claiming some 700 lives.
ON THIS DATE
1961
The first Boeing CH-47 Chinook military helicopter made its first hovering flight.
1981
The Senate unanimously confirmed the nomination of Sandra Day O’Connor to become the first female justice on the Supreme Court.
2008
Baseball said farewell to the original Yankee Stadium as the Bronx Bombers defeated the Baltimore Orioles 7-3.
